How much do remote behavioral analysis unit fbi jobs pay per year?

As of May 28, 2026, the average yearly pay for remote behavioral analysis unit fbi in Spring, TX is $65,435.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$57,800.00 and $70,700.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Remote Behavioral Analysis Unit FBI agent,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Behavioral Analysis Unit FBI agent, you need advanced skills in criminal psychology, behavioral analysis, and investigative techniques, typically supported by a relevant degree and FBI training. Familiarity with forensic software, case management systems, and secure communication tools is crucial. Strong analytical thinking, attention to detail, and effective collaboration are vital soft skills for interpreting behavior and working with multidisciplinary teams. These skills and qualifications are essential for accurately assessing threats, supporting investigations, and maintaining national security in remote environments.

How does working remotely in the FBI Behavioral Analysis Unit impact the collaboration and communication with on-site team members?

Remote members of the FBI Behavioral Analysis Unit (BAU) often rely on secure digital communication tools to collaborate with on-site colleagues, analysts, and law enforcement partners. While the remote setup allows flexibility, it can present challenges such as coordinating across time zones and ensuring sensitive information remains protected. Regular video conferences, secure messaging, and virtual case briefings are essential for maintaining strong teamwork and effective decision-making. Remote analysts are expected to be proactive in communication, participate in ongoing training, and stay updated on evolving investigative techniques.

What is a Remote Behavioral Analysis Unit FBI agent?

A Remote Behavioral Analysis Unit (BAU) FBI agent is a specialized professional who analyzes criminal behavior and patterns from a distance, often using digital tools and telecommunication technology. These agents work as part of the FBI's Behavioral Analysis Unit, providing expert insights into criminal cases, offender profiling, and threat assessments. While traditional BAU agents may work onsite at crime scenes, remote BAU agents support investigations by collaborating with field agents and law enforcement partners virtually. Their work is crucial in identifying, understanding, and predicting criminal actions to support law enforcement efforts across the country.
